+def iou(box1, box2):
|
|
|
+ x1, y1, w1, h1 = box1.x, box1.y, box1.w, box1.h
|
|
|
+ x2, y2, w2, h2 = box2.x, box2.y, box2.w, box2.h
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 S_1 = w1 * h1
|
|
|
+ S_2 = w2 * h2
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 xmin_1, ymin_1 = x1 - w1 / 2, y1 - h1 / 2
|
|
|
+ xmax_1, ymax_1 = x1 + w1 / 2, y1 + h1 / 2
|
|
|
+ xmin_2, ymin_2 = x2 - w2 / 2, y2 - h2 / 2
|
|
|
+ xmax_2, ymax_2 = x2 + w2 / 2, y2 + h2 / 2
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 I_w = min(xmax_1, xmax_2) - max(xmin_1, xmin_2)
|
|
|
+ I_h = min(ymax_1, ymax_2) - max(ymin_1, ymin_2)
|
|
|
+ if I_w < 0 or I_h < 0:
|
|
|
+ return 0
|
|
|
+ I = I_w * I_h
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 IoU = I / (S_1 + S_2 - I)
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 return IoU

+def init_centroids(boxes, n_anchors):
|
|
|
+ centroids = []
|
|
|
+ boxes_num = len(boxes)
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 centroid_index = int(np.random.choice(boxes_num, 1)[0])
|
|
|
+ centroids.append(boxes[centroid_index])
|
|
|
+ print(centroids[0].w,centroids[0].h)
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 for centroid_index in range(0, n_anchors-1):
|
|
|
+ sum_distance = 0
|
|
|
+ distance_thresh = 0
|
|
|
+ distance_list = []
|
|
|
+ cur_sum = 0
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 for box in boxes:
|
|
|
+ min_distance = 1
|
|
|
+ for centroid_i, centroid in enumerate(centroids):
|
|
|
+ distance = (1 - iou(box, centroid))
|
|
|
+ if distance < min_distance:
|
|
|
+ min_distance = distance
|
|
|
+ sum_distance += min_distance
|
|
|
+ distance_list.append(min_distance)
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 distance_thresh = sum_distance * np.random.random()
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 for i in range(0, boxes_num):
|
|
|
+ cur_sum += distance_list[i]
|
|
|
+ if cur_sum > distance_thresh:
|
|
|
+ centroids.append(boxes[i])
|
|
|
+ print(boxes[i].w, boxes[i].h)
|
|
|
+ break
|
|
|
+ return centroids
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+def do_kmeans(n_anchors, boxes, centroids):
|
|
|
+ loss = 0
|
|
|
+ groups = []
|
|
|
+ new_centroids = []
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 for i in range(n_anchors):
|
|
|
+ groups.append([])
|
|
|
+ new_centroids.append(Box(0, 0, 0, 0))
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 for box in boxes:
|
|
|
+ min_distance = 1
|
|
|
+ group_index = 0
|
|
|
+ for centroid_index, centroid in enumerate(centroids):
|
|
|
+ distance = (1 - iou(box, centroid))
|
|
|
+ if distance < min_distance:
|
|
|
+ min_distance = distance
|
|
|
+ group_index = centroid_index
|
|
|
+ groups[group_index].append(box)
|
|
|
+ loss += min_distance
|
|
|
+ new_centroids[group_index].w += box.w
|
|
|
+ new_centroids[group_index].h += box.h
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 for i in range(n_anchors):
|
|
|
+ new_centroids[i].w /= max(len(groups[i]), 1)
|
|
|
+ new_centroids[i].h /= max(len(groups[i]), 1)
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 return new_centroids, groups, loss# / len(boxes)
